Description:
This project was conducted in order to enact social change-- changing the school, community, and world, and increase voting in Clearwater County-- based on ideas for community and world decided by students. The goals of this project were enhanced civic education and responsibility, knowledge of history, current events, and the role of the citizen in our world. The idea for this project was brought about by the need to create a more informed and engaged citizenry.
